Zesty Homemade Cranberry Sauce – How To Make

I love making cranberry sauce from scratch every holiday season. It’s a simple recipe that adds a fresh and tangy flavor to any meal. With just a few ingredients, I can create a sauce that perfectly complements turkey or ham.

The process is straightforward, and the result is always satisfying. Let me share my go-to recipe for this classic side dish.

Ingredients:

  • 12 oz fresh cranberries
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up water
  • Zest of one orange (optional)
  • Juice of one orange (optional)
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Cranberries: Rinse the cranberries under cold water and discard any that are soft or damaged.
  2. Combine Ingredients: In a medium saucepan, combine the water and sugar.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, stirring occasionally to dissolve the sugar.
  3. Add Cranberries: Once the sugar has dissolved, add the cranberries to the saucepan. Stir to combine.
  4. Cook: Reduce the heat to medium and cook the cranberries, stirring occasionally. As the cranberries cook, they will begin to pop. This should take about 10 minutes.
  5. Optional Additions: If using, add the orange zest, orange juice, and cinnamon to the saucepan. Stir to combine and continue to cook for another 5 minutes, until the sauce has thickened to your desired consistency.
  6. Cool: Remove the saucepan from heat and allow the cranberry sauce to cool completely. The sauce will continue to thicken as it cools.
  7. Serve: Transfer the cranberry sauce to a serving dish. It can be served immediately or refrigerated until ready to use.
